The price of the project shotgun will be:

$142 (auction price)
$15 (1/2 of combined shipping)
$10 (1/2 of combined transfer fee)
$35 (folding buttstock)
$20 (mag tube extension)
$212 (total price)

I may decide to gunkote it at a later date, but that is pretty cheap, and might be paid for by selling the unused buttstock and choke.

For $212 I will end up with a gun that will complement the 28" barrel 870 I got. I will also have the pleasure of doing a fun project.

If I could have found an 870 riotgun with a folding stock for that price I would have bought it, but they cost more than a standard 28" express.
